Cotas e limites

O Cloud Trace aplica dois tipos diferentes de cotas: uma cota de taxa nas suas solicitações de API e uma cota de ingestão de períodos que você envia ao Trace.

Cotas do Trace

A tabela a seguir resume as unidades de cota disponíveis para operações de leitura e gravação e a cota diária para ingestão de períodos. Por exemplo, você tem um total de 300 a cada 60 segundos para os três comandos de API GetTrace, ListTraces e ListSpan. Veja a seguir dois exemplos diferentes de como você poderia usar todas as unidades de cota disponíveis:

  • Faça 12 chamadas de API ListTraces a cada 60 segundos.
  • Faça 10 chamadas de API ListTraces e 50 de GetTrace a cada 60 segundos.
Categoria Unidades de cota totais
Operações de leitura1 300 a cada 60 segundos
Operações de gravação2 4.800 a cada 60 segundos
Períodos ingeridos3 3.000.000 a 5.000.000.000 por dia

1 As operações de leitura incluem GetTrace, ListTraces e ListSpan. Uma chamada para ListTraces consome 25 unidades de cota. As chamadas para GetTrace consomem ListSpan 1 unidade de cota.
2 As operações de gravação incluem PatchTraces, BatchWrite e CreateSpan. Cada operação de gravação consome 1 unidade de cota.
3 Sua cota diária de ingestão de períodos de trace é determinada pelo histórico da conta de faturamento e as solicitações que você fez para aumentar a cota.

Limites de traces

Nesta seção, listamos os limites que se aplicam ao usar a API Cloud Trace.

Limites para métodos da API

Limites para métodos da API Valor
Número máximo de períodos por chamada GetTrace 1.000
Número máximo de períodos por chamada PatchTraces 25.000
Número máximo de traces por chamada do ListTraces 1.000 nas visualizações ROOTSPAN e MINIMAL
100 na visualização COMPLETE

Limites de períodos

Limites de períodos Valor
Tamanho máximo de um nome de período 128 bytes
Número máximo de rótulos ou atributos por período 32
Tamanho máximo da chave de um rótulo ou atributo 128 bytes
Tamanho máximo do valor de um rótulo ou atributo 256 bytes
Número máximo de eventos por período 128
Carimbo de data/hora passado máximo para um período ser ingerido 14 dias
Carimbo de data/hora futuro máximo para um período a ser ingerido 3 dias
Carimbo de data/hora passado máximo do evento em relação ao carimbo de data/hora do período 365 dias

É possível anotar períodos criando um objeto attributes e anexando-o ao objeto Span ao usar a API Cloud Trace v2 batchWrite. Da mesma forma, é possível anotar períodos criando um objeto labels e anexando-o ao objeto TraceSpan ao usar o método patchTraces da API Cloud Trace v1.

Limites de traces

Limites de traces Valor
Número máximo de períodos por trace 1.000
Tamanho máximo do trace 50 MB

Períodos de retenção do Trace

Categoria Período de armazenamento
Dados do período armazenados pelo Cloud Trace 30 dias
Relatórios de análise 30 dias

Gerenciar sua cota

Nesta seção, descrevemos como solicitar uma alteração em uma cota e monitorar o uso dela.

Solicitar alterações na cota da API Cloud Trace

É possível solicitar limites maiores ou menores da API Cloud Trace usando o console do Google Cloud:

  1. Na página "Cotas" do Console do Google Cloud, use as caixas de seleção para selecionar API Cloud Trace e clique em Editar cotas.

    Se aparecer um erro Edit is not allowed for this quota, entre em contato com o suporte para solicitar alterações na cota. Observe também que o faturamento precisa estar ativado no projeto do Google Cloud para que seja possível marcar as caixas de seleção.

  2. No painel Alterações de cota, selecione o serviço para expandir a visualização e preencha os campos Novo limite e Descrição da solicitação. Clique em Próxima.

  3. Preencha o formulário no painel Detalhes do contato.

  4. Clique em Enviar solicitação.

Para mais informações, consulte Ver e gerenciar cotas.

Monitorar o uso da cota

Para garantir que você não fique sem cota e não perca a capacidade de observação do desempenho dos seus apps, agrupe as atualizações em lote e monitore o uso da cota. Por exemplo, é possível criar uma política de alertas que notifica quando o uso excede um limite. Para informações detalhadas sobre como monitorar suas solicitações de API e entender as respostas, consulte Como monitorar o uso da API.

  • Para ver sua API Cloud Trace e suas cotas de ingestão diária de períodos, consulte Visualizar e gerenciar cotas.

  • Para saber como reduzir suas unidades de cota de API e de ingestão diária de períodos, consulte Como limitar o uso.

  • Para solicitar um aumento das suas unidades de cota de API ou de ingestão diária de períodos, consulte Solicitar mais cota.

  • Veja Como criar um alerta de ultrapassagem de cota para informações detalhadas sobre como criar políticas de alerta a fim de monitorar sua cota da API Trace e sua ingestão de períodos de trace.